Orphans¶
This is a version of the orphan example from
Jorge Fandinno, Zachary Hansen, Yuliya Lierler, Vladimir Lifschitz, Nathan Temple. External Behavior of a Logic Program and Verification of Refactoring. TPLP 23(4): 933-947 (2023). doi:10.1017/S1471068423000200
The example determines which living people are orphans. The input is given by
the parent relations father/2 and mother/2 together with the people who are
living (living/1). The output is the set of orphans (orphan/1).
input: father/2.
input: mother/2.
input: living/1.
output: orphan/1.
The two programs compute the orphans in different ways. The first program,
orphan.1.lp, derives an auxiliary predicate parent_living/1 for every person
who has a living parent and then marks every living person without a living
parent as an orphan. The second program, orphan.2.lp, directly marks a living
person as an orphan if it has a father and a mother that are both not living.
parent_living(X) :- father(Y,X), living(Y).
parent_living(X) :- mother(Y,X), living(Y).
orphan(X) :- living(X), not parent_living(X).
orphan(X) :- living(X), father(Y,X), mother(Z,X),
not living(Y), not living(Z).
The two programs are not externally equivalent. Running
anthem-cx orphan.1.lp orphan.2.lp orphan.ug
finds a counterexample of size 1. The two programs disagree on a living person
whose parents are not recorded: orphan.1.lp considers such a person an orphan,
while orphan.2.lp does not, as it requires both a father and a mother to be
present.
Including assumptions¶
The program assumptions.lp adds the assumption that every living person has
exactly one father and exactly one mother.
:- living(X), not #count{ Y : father(Y,X) } = 1.
:- living(X), not #count{ Y : mother(Y,X) } = 1.
To check for counterexamples under these assumptions, run
anthem-cx orphan.1.lp orphan.2.lp orphan.ug --assumptions assumptions.lp --max 5
Under these assumptions the two programs are equivalent, so no counterexample is
found. As the search would otherwise keep increasing the domain size
indefinitely, we limit it with --max 5.
Verifying equivalence¶
The user guide orphan-assumptions.ug extends orphan.ug with the two
first-order assumptions that every living person has exactly one father and
exactly one mother. Using this extended user guide, the equivalence of the two
programs can be verified with the verification mode of
anthem:
anthem verify --equivalence external orphan.1.lp orphan.2.lp orphan-assumptions.ug
